<br />City of Sunny Isles Beach |Request for Proposals Disaster Debris Monitoring No. 18-04-03 33 <br /> <br /> <br /> Section 4 <br />Evaluation Process <br /> <br />4.1 Review of Proposals For Responsiveness <br /> <br />Each proposal will be reviewed to determine if the proposal is responsive to the submission <br />requirements outlined in the solicitation. A responsive proposal is one which follows the <br />requirements of this solicitation that includes all documentation, is submitted in the format <br />outlined in this solicitation, is of timely submission, and has the appropriate sign atures as <br />required on each document. Failure to comply with these requirements may result in the <br />proposal being deemed non-responsive. The City reserves the right to select the Consultant <br />who represents the best value, and to accept or reject any proposal submitted in response <br />to this solicitation. <br /> <br /> EVALUATION METHOD AND CRITERIA <br />The City will consider the following factors below in evaluating the qualifications of the <br />bidders: <br /> <br />QUALIFICATIONS AND EXPERIENCE <br />1. i. Firm’s background, history and overall experience. <br />ii. Firm’s expertise and experience in performing proposed work. <br />iii. Firm's experience in filing and receiving Federal and State reimbursements. <br />iv. Staff experience and resumes- specifically, operational and administrative <br />personnel assigned to the City. <br />v. Certified Minority/Woman Business Enterprise participation and/or Small <br />Business Enterprise participation <br />OPERATIONAL PLAN FOR THE CITY <br />2. i. Response times and operational plans for monitoring debris recovery. <br />ii. Procedures for documentation and verification functions. <br />iii. Organizational structure of firm, chain of command, subcontractor's plan. <br />iv. Onsite emergency response and communications. Quality control and <br />customer service plans. <br />RESOURCES AND AVAILABILITY <br />3. i. Plan for managing multiple Florida-based debris monitoring contracts. <br />ii. Demonstrated financial capability <br />PAST PERFORMANCE <br />i. Reference Checks.
